广告
返回顶部
首页 > 资讯 > 后端开发 > Python >python 练习题之【数字排序】
  • 710
分享到

python 练习题之【数字排序】

练习题数字python 2023-01-31 06:01:55 710人浏览 薄情痞子

Python 官方文档:入门教程 => 点击学习

摘要

今天linux技术圈的逗哥出了道题,题目很简单 要求: 2 9 5 7 6 1 4 8 3 5 4 2 求每行的最大值 最近刚好在学习python,感觉py也可以做出来。   #!/usr/bin/env Pytho

今天linux技术圈的逗哥出了道题,题目很简单

要求:

2 9 5 7
6 1 4 8
3 5 4 2 求每行的最大值

最近刚好在学习python,感觉py也可以做出来。

 

  1. #!/usr/bin/env Python 
  2. # -*- condig:utf-8 -*- 
  3.  
  4. alist = [2,9,5,7] 
  5. print sorted(alist,reverse=True)[0] 
  6.  
  7. blist = [6,1,4,8] 
  8. print sorted(blist,reverse=True)[0] 
  9.  
  10. clist = [3,5,4,2] 
  11. print sorted(clist,reverse=True)[0] 

 

思路:首先将需要对比的数字放到列表当中,然后使用函数sorted进行排序,最后用索引操作符[0]取出排序之后的第一个,然后打印出来。

有朋友问提了,如果要对比的数字不止这三行,有100行,难道要手动写100行吗?

我的思路是之后就要考虑怎么样将这100 行内容,与列表匹配起来了,后续有需求咱们在进一步探讨。

 

 

                                                                            2012/11/21

--结束END--

本文标题: python 练习题之【数字排序】

本文链接: https://www.lsjlt.com/news/190553.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• python 练习题之【数字排序】
    今天linux技术圈的逗哥出了道题,题目很简单 要求: 2 9 5 7 6 1 4 8 3 5 4 2 求每行的最大值 最近刚好在学习python,感觉py也可以做出来。   #!/usr/bin/env pytho...
    99+
    2023-01-31
    练习题 数字 python
  • python 小练习之冒泡排序
    冒泡排序:多重循环#!/usr/bin/env python # _*_ coding:utf-8 _*_ def bubbleSort(numbers):     for j in range(len(numbers)-1, -1, -1...
    99+
    2023-01-31
    python
  • 小猿圈python之练习题
    很多朋友通过自学来学习python,只是一味的看视频,从来不知道自己动手练习一下,实践是检验自己学没学会的唯一真理,今天小猿圈加加针对自学的朋友出一道经典的练习题,检验一下学习的程度,面试的小伙伴也可以看看哦,可能在面试的过程中也会遇到,...
    99+
    2023-01-31
    练习题 小猿圈 python
  • C语言算法练习之数组元素排序
    目录一、问题描述二、算法实例编译环境三、算法实例实现过程3.1、包含头文件3.2、定义宏和声明数组3.3、声明相关变量3.4、随机生成十个数字赋值给数组3.5、输出随机生成的十个数字...
    99+
    2022-11-13
  • C语言每日练习之选择排序
    目录分析代码实现总结分析 选择排序(Selection sort)是一种简单直观的排序算法。它的工作原理是:第一次从待排序的数据元素中选出最小(或最大)的一个元素,存放在序列的起始位...
    99+
    2022-11-12
  • C语言每日练习之冒泡排序
    目录分析代码实现运行结果总结分析 冒泡排序(Bubble Sort),是一种计算机科学领域的较简单的排序算法。 冒泡排序(这里只讨论从小到大排序)可以通过二种方式实现,分别是将最小...
    99+
    2022-11-12
  • Python练习之操作MySQL数据库
    目录一、创建mysql数据表三、向MySQL表中插入数据三、查询MySQL中的数据总结文章介绍内容: 操作MySQL数据库: 创建MySQL数据表;向表中插入记录;其他数据库操作。 面试题: 如何创建MySQL数据表?如...
    99+
    2022-06-13
    Python操作MySQL数据库 Python操作MySQL
  • Python练习之操作SQLite数据库
    目录前言1.创建SQLite数据库2.向SQLite表中插入数据3.查询SQLite表中的数据总结前言 文章包括下几点: 考点--操作SQLite数据库: 创建SQLite数据库;向表中插入记录;其他数据库操作。 面试题...
    99+
    2022-06-13
    Python操作SQLite数据库 操作SQLite数据库
  • python学习之数字
    目录 python学习之数字 1.python数值类型 2. 数字类型转换 3. 常用函数 3.1 数学函数 ...
    99+
    2023-01-30
    数字 python
  • Python基础学习之深浅拷贝问题及递归函数练习
    目录一、深浅拷贝问题二、递归函数练习1. 求阶乘2. 猴子吃桃问题3. 打印斐波那契数列一、深浅拷贝问题 在实际工作中,经常涉及到数据的传递,在数据传递使用过程中,可能会发生数据被修...
    99+
    2022-11-12
  • python基本数据类型练习题
    题目[1]:格式输出练习。在交互式状态下完成以下练习。 运行结果截图: 题目[2]:格式输出练习。在.py的文件中完成以下练习 代码: num = 100 print('%d ...
    99+
    2022-11-13
  • python-练习实现猜数字的循环
    目录:input:输入print:输出int:整数型if循环:如果elif:或者else:否则break:结束本次循环python语言是从上到下一句一句执行的。代码部分:#!/usr/bin/env python # -*- coding:...
    99+
    2023-01-31
    数字 python
  • Python练习【3】【罗马数字转换/查
    题目1:罗马数字转换 罗马数字包含以下七种字符: I, V, X, L,C,D 和 M字符 数值I 1V 5X 10L 50...
    99+
    2023-01-31
    罗马数字 Python
  • Python中def()函数的实战练习题
    目录一、判断以下哪些不能作为标识符 A、aB、¥aC、_12D、$a@12E、falseF、False 答案为:(F、D、B、E) 二、输入数,判断这个数是否是质数(要求使用函数 +...
    99+
    2022-11-11
  • Python实例练习逆序输出字符串讲解
    目录1. 问题描述2. 算法思路3. 代码实现第一种切片方式第二种循环转换1. 问题描述 输入一个字符串然后对其进行逆序输出 第一种方式:字符串切片第二种方式:使用循环转换然后逆序输...
    99+
    2022-11-11
  • python学习:读写文件和字典排序
              今天来做一个题目,有一个文件,内容如下:[root@Virtual python]# cat a.csv  源文件2004-5-27,2,3,2,3 2004-5-27,872,0,872,0 2004-5-2...
    99+
    2023-01-31
    字典 文件 python
  • PHP反序列化漏洞之产生原因(题目练习)
    1、反序列化漏洞的产生 PHP反序列化漏洞又叫做PHP对象注入漏洞,是因为程序对输入的序列化后的字符串处理不当导致的。反序列化漏洞的成因在于代码中的unserialize()接收参数可控,导致代码执行,SQL注入,目录遍历,getshell...
    99+
    2023-09-09
    php 安全 web安全
  • php之二维数组排序问题
    目录php二维数组排序php二维数组排序算法函数总结php二维数组排序 测试数据         $arr = [             'a' => ['a' => ...
    99+
    2023-03-23
    php二维数组排序 php二维数组 php排序
  • Python学习小技巧之列表项的排序
    本文介绍的是关于Python列表项排序的相关内容,分享出来供大家参考学习,下面来看看详细的介绍: 典型代码1: data_list = [6, 9, 1, 3, 0, 10, 100, -100] d...
    99+
    2022-06-04
    小技巧 列表 Python
  • oracle菜鸟学习之 分析函数-排序
    oracle菜鸟学习之 分析函数-排序 排序函数 1.row_number:返回连续的排序,无论值是否相等2.rank:具有相等值得行排序相同,序数值随后跳跃3.dense_rank:具有相等值得行排序相同...
    99+
    2022-10-18
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作